next-auth v5 beta.30 cannot reliably pass the /hp-prod-tracker prefix
through OAuth redirect_uri — redirectProxyUrl is silently ignored.
Instead: AUTH_URL=https://…/api/auth (matches basePath exactly), Auth.js
sends consistent redirect_uri in both authorization and token exchange,
Apache proxies /api/auth → :3001 before the OliVAS /api/ rule.
Azure must have https://optical-dev.oliver.solutions/api/auth/callback/microsoft-entra-id registered.
Server .env: AUTH_URL=https://optical-dev.oliver.solutions/api/auth
